Output e8fa20b93502e41ea0f20ff091e8e6ef34eff56237cc0dbf87a0e6e77b44ec5e:0

value
959231177
script pubkey
OP_0 OP_PUSHBYTES_20 d8bee90102b1637a0d735032f31a78400f2fb37f
address
tb1qmzlwjqgzk93h5rtn2qe0xxncgq8jlvmlrc2948
transaction
e8fa20b93502e41ea0f20ff091e8e6ef34eff56237cc0dbf87a0e6e77b44ec5e
confirmations
107392
spent
true